Sleep

Vue. js functionality regulations: v-once - Vue.js Nourished

.Making efficiency is actually a vital statistics for frontend programmers. For each 2nd your webpage needs to make, the bounce rate boosts.And also when it involves developing a hassle-free user expertise? Near quick reviews is actually essential to offering people a reactive application take in.While Vue is actually among the better performing JavaScript frameworks out of package, there are ways that creators can easily strengthen the performance of their apps.There are a number of methods to improve the making of Vue applications - ranging from digital scrolling to optimizing your v-for elements.However one very quick and easy technique to improve rendering is actually by only re-rendering what you need to have to.Whenever a component's records improvements, that component as well as its own children will definitely re-render, there are actually means to deal with unneeded duties along with a lesser-used Vue directive: v-once.Let's hop right in as well as find just how our team may utilize this in our app.v-once.The v-once instruction leaves the element/component the moment and also just when. After the initial leave, this aspect plus all of its kids will certainly be actually treated as fixed web content.This could be great for improving leave efficiency in your application.To utilize this, all our team have to perform is incorporate v-once to the factor in our design template. Our company do not also require to include an expression like a few of Vue's different ordinances.msgIt deals with single aspects, components along with children, parts, v-for directives, just about anything in your layout.// ~ app.vue.
msgnotice
productSo permit's claim we have this instance layout with some responsive data, a paragraph with v-once, and a button that transforms the text message.// ~ vonceexample.vue.
msgModification message.Current condition:.msg: msg
When our team click our switch, we may view that despite the fact that the value of msg improvements, the paragraph carries out certainly not transform thanks to v-once.When used with v-if or v-show, when our component is actually rendered the moment, the v-if or even v-show will definitely no more administer meaning that if it's visible on the very first leave, it will definitely constantly be visible. And if it's concealed, it will certainly consistently be hidden.
msgButton.Modification message.Present state:.msg: msg
When will I use v-once?You need to use v-once if there is actually no situation that you will need to have to re-render a factor. A couple instances may be:.Displaying account information in the sidebar.Showing article text.Continuing the pillar names in a dining table.Clearly, there are actually lots of various other examples - however only think about if this functions properly in your app.